When ravens first hatch, they are altricial—meaning they are nearly featherless, blind, and entirely dependent on their parents. According to the Cornell Lab of Ornithology , they remain in the nest for about 4 to 7 weeks. raven mature naked

Observers often see mature ravens performing aerial acrobatics, such as mid-air somersaults or flying upside down, simply for social bonding or play.
